What Is AI Permission Hygiene?

AI permission hygiene is the habit of managing what your AI tools can see, read, and do.

It is the same idea as password hygiene, two-factor authentication, or phone app permissions. You would not give every app on your phone access to your camera, contacts, microphone, and location. The same thinking applies to AI tools.

As AI tools become more connected and more agentic, the permissions you grant them matter more. A chatbot that only reads your typed input is low risk. An AI agent with access to your inbox, files, and the ability to send messages on your behalf is a different conversation entirely.

The Beginner Mistake: Clicking Allow Without Thinking

Most people approve permissions quickly. The screen looks familiar. It is the same style as connecting Google to a third-party app. It feels routine.

But AI permission prompts often include scope that most users do not read:

  • Access your email: read, search, sometimes send
  • Access your files: read, create, edit, delete
  • Access your calendar: read events, create or cancel meetings
  • Read and send messages: Slack, Teams, WhatsApp integrations
  • Manage documents: edit, share, delete
  • Access your browser: click, fill forms, navigate pages
  • Act on your behalf: a wide permission that can cover almost anything

Before connecting any AI tool to any account, ask one question: Does this tool actually need this permission to do the job I want it to do?

Often the answer is no.


What You Should Never Give AI Access To Without Thinking First

Full email send access

Your email contains private conversations, reset links, invoices, contracts, client communication, and business details. Read-only access for summarizing or searching is a reasonable tradeoff. Giving an AI the ability to send emails, reply to messages, or forward conversations without your explicit approval is a much higher-risk decision.

Safer rule: Use read-only email access where possible. Require human confirmation before any AI sends, replies, or deletes.

Payment and billing tools

An AI connected to your payment tools, billing system, or bank account can trigger purchases, process refunds, or make financial changes based on an instruction you may not have intended, or one that was injected from outside your input.

Safer rule: Keep payments, purchases, refunds, and financial approvals entirely human-controlled. No AI should have unreviewed access to money.

File deletion or editing access

An AI assistant with permission to edit or delete files can cause real damage if it follows the wrong instruction. A misunderstood command or an injected instruction could result in deleted files, overwritten documents, or edited records that are hard to recover.

Safer rule: Allow file search and summarization before allowing editing. Never allow deletion without a manual confirmation step.

Browser control

Browser agents are useful. They can automate repetitive tasks, fill forms, and navigate apps. They can also click buttons, submit purchases, change account settings, and interact with websites you did not intend to visit.

Safer rule: Use browser agents for low-risk workflows first. Require human confirmation before any submission, purchase, account change, or deletion.

Admin access

Admin-level permissions inside business tools give the holder, including AI, significant control over settings, data, users, and integrations. Giving AI admin access to your CRM, email platform, project management tool, or workspace creates a very wide blast radius if something goes wrong.

Safer rule: Never give AI admin access unless there is a specific, tested, and regularly reviewed reason to do so.

Private messages and notifications

Messages and notifications often contain sensitive information, financial details, personal conversations, health information, confidential business discussions. They are also a common surface for prompt injection attacks, where malicious instructions can be hidden inside what looks like a normal message.

Safer rule: Do not give AI broad notification or messaging access unless you understand exactly how the tool processes and stores that data.

Customer data and CRM systems

Connecting AI to a CRM or customer database raises questions about data privacy, compliance, and error risk. An AI making changes to customer records, sending customer-facing messages, or accessing contact information without human review creates real business and legal exposure.

Safer rule: Start with read-only CRM access. Require human approval before any AI takes customer-facing action.


The Gemini Example: Why This Is Not Theoretical

In a widely discussed demonstration, researchers showed how Google Gemini, which reads notifications to provide context-aware assistance, could be manipulated through a normal-looking WhatsApp message.

A message containing hidden instructions could cause Gemini to act on those instructions as if they were legitimate context, not as an attack.

This is called indirect prompt injection. The user never typed anything dangerous. The dangerous instruction came from content the AI read on their behalf.

What Is Indirect Prompt Injection?

There are two types of prompt injection:

Direct prompt injection is when someone tells an AI directly, often through a jailbreak or trick, to ignore its instructions or do something unsafe.

Indirect prompt injection is when malicious instructions are hidden inside something the AI reads. The user never types those instructions. The AI encounters them inside:

  • An email or reply
  • A WhatsApp or Slack message
  • A calendar invite
  • A document or PDF
  • A website or web page
  • A support ticket or notification

A simple way to think about it: it is like a stranger slipping fake instructions into a folder your assistant is supposed to read. Your assistant follows them because they were in the folder, not because you put them there.

The more an AI can read, the more surfaces exist for this kind of manipulation. Good AI permission hygiene limits those surfaces.


High-Risk vs Lower-Risk AI Permissions

Not every permission carries the same level of risk.

High-risk, requires careful consideration:

  • Send email or messages
  • Delete files, records, or data
  • Edit documents or code
  • Make purchases or trigger payments
  • Control browser actions
  • Change account or app settings
  • Access admin panels
  • Update or message CRM contacts

Medium-risk, useful but worth monitoring:

  • Read inbox or calendar
  • Search documents and files
  • Read Slack, Teams, or notification feeds
  • Access project management tools
  • Summarize private files

Lower-risk, generally safer starting points:

  • Isolated chat window
  • Temporary file upload for a single session
  • Read-only public data
  • Manual copy-paste input
  • Local draft generation without connected accounts

Lower risk does not mean zero risk. It means the potential damage is smaller and easier to control.


The AI Permission Hygiene Checklist

Ask these questions before connecting any AI tool to any account:

  • What data can this tool actually see after I connect it?
  • Can it only read data, or can it also take action?
  • Can it send emails, messages, or notifications?
  • Can it delete, edit, move, or publish anything?
  • Can it access payment, billing, or customer data?
  • Does it need this permission for the task I want to do?
  • Can I use read-only access instead?
  • Can I disconnect it easily later?
  • Does the tool explain clearly how it stores or uses my data?
  • Are risky actions confirmed by me before they happen?
  • Is this a trusted, established tool or a random new AI app?
  • Am I connecting personal data, business data, or client data?

A Safer Way to Use AI Assistants

You do not need to avoid connected AI tools. You need to approach them with more intention.

Practical habits for safer AI use:

  • Start with copy-paste before connecting accounts. Test whether the AI produces useful results before giving it access to your real data.
  • Use read-only permissions first. You can always expand access later. You cannot undo a mistake that happened before you understood the risk.
  • Require approval before high-stakes actions. If an AI can send, delete, buy, or publish, that action should require your confirmation every time.
  • Review connected apps once a month. It takes five minutes. Disconnect anything you no longer use.
  • Keep sensitive accounts separate. Do not connect your main business email to an AI tool you are testing for the first time.
  • Test on low-risk workflows first. Build trust before expanding access.
  • Remove AI tools you no longer use. Old integrations that still have permissions are a quiet risk.

The concept of human-in-the-loop is useful here: for anything that matters, keep a human approval step in the process. Do not let AI take irreversible action without your sign-off.


When It Is Okay to Give AI More Access

Broader permissions are not always the wrong call. More access makes sense when:

  • The tool is established and well-reviewed
  • The task genuinely requires that access to work
  • The data involved is not highly sensitive
  • Permissions are scoped narrowly to what is needed
  • High-stakes actions still require your confirmation
  • You have a clear benefit and have tested on low-risk tasks first
  • You can revoke access immediately if needed

The goal of AI permission hygiene is not minimal access at all costs. It is intentional access, knowing what you gave, why you gave it, and how to take it back.
